• 24-02-2009, 21:24:26
    #1
    Üyeliği durduruldu
    arkadşlar localimde cookie ile ilgili birşeyler yapıyordum ama foreacda su hatayı aldım daha dorusu videlu ders izliom bakıom aynısını yazıyom ama olmuyor o hataı veriyor hata

    Warning: Invalid argument supplied for foreach() in C:\AppServ\www\php\cookie\profil.php on line 14
    profil.php

    <?php
    
    $yonlendirme1= "<meta http-equiv='Refresh' content='2; URL=profil.php'>";
    
    
    $uyeprofil = $_COOKIE["UYE"];
    
    if($uyeprofil==""){
    echo "Çikis Yapildi"."<br>";
    echo $yonlendirme1;
    
    }else {
    
    foreach($uyeprofil as $yenidegisken => $yenidegiskendegeri){
    echo "$uyeprofil = $yenidegiskendegeri";
    
    }
    
    echo "<a href='logout.php'>Çikis Yap</a>";
    
    
    
    
    }
    
    ?>
  • 24-02-2009, 21:29:41
    #2
    $uyeprofil değeri dolumu?
  • 24-02-2009, 21:32:06
    #3
    Üyeliği durduruldu
    evet dolu
  • 24-02-2009, 21:32:37
    #4
    foreach($uyeprofil as $yenidegisken){


    şeklinde değiştirirmisin bir de .
  • 24-02-2009, 21:34:34
    #5
    Üyeliği durduruldu
    Aynı isterseniz tüm dosyaların kodlarını veriyim
  • 24-02-2009, 21:36:41
    #6
    $uyeprofil bir dizi değişkenimi? yoksa normal bi değermi var???
  • 24-02-2009, 21:36:56
    #7
    foreach($_COOKIE as $yenidegisken => $yenidegiskendegeri){

    bir de print_r($_COOKIE); denermisin foreachten önce
  • 24-02-2009, 21:39:04
    #8
    Üyeliği durduruldu
    Array ( [UYE] => ChanLee )
    Warning: Invalid argument supplied for foreach() in C:\AppServ\www\php\cookie\profil.php on line 16
    Çikis Yap
    bu seferde böyle yaptı ama foreach ın hemen üstüne ekledim o kodu ben o kodu bilmiyorm o yüzden anlamadıım icin foreachın hemen üstüne koydum sende oyle diyince ?
  • 24-02-2009, 21:41:52
    #9
    foreach($_COOKIE as $yenidegisken => $yenidegiskendegeri){

    bunu denemişmiydin ?